Ap photographer, his leg lost, seeks answers on disability from paralympians
Yahoo - World·2021-09-08 06:05
When I last saw Freddie de los Santos, his mouth was ravaged ― his teeth had been blown away by the same blast that took his leg. And yet, he always smiled.
The year was 2009. We were both being treated at Walter Reed National Military Medical Center; I too had lost a leg in southern Afghanistan. We spent months together, the soldier and the photographer, and he would tell me of his exhaustion, his trauma and his nightmares.
